DETAILED DESCRIPTION OF THE INVENTION Object of the Invention [Industrial Application Field] The present invention relates to a film drawn from a film take-up roll in a packaging machine for packaging, for example, a tray containing perishables and the like with a stretch film. The present invention relates to a device for confirming the supply to the packaging unit.

[Prior Art] A conventional packaging machine is disclosed in, for example, Japanese Patent Application Laid-Open No. 58-90010. This packaging machine has a film take-up roll support device, a film supply device that supplies a film drawn from the film take-up roll to a packaging portion, and a tray placed below the packaging portion to ascend and descend. ,
An article receiving device that lifts the film by bringing the tray into contact with the film supplied to the packaging unit, an article conveying device that supplies the tray onto the article receiving table of the article receiving device, and a position fixed in the packaging unit. A film folding device that allows the rear folding member to approach and separate from the front folding member, opens and closes both left and right folding members in accordance with the approach and separation of the rear folding member, and folds the film below the tray. The apparatus includes a heater device provided on the carry-out side of the film folding device and connected to the front folding member, and an article carrying device provided above the film folding device.

[Problems to be Solved by the Invention] In these wrapping machines, it is impossible to detect whether or not the film drawn from the film winding roll is actually supplied to the wrapping unit by the film supply device. Even though the paper was not supplied to the packaging section, it could happen that the fold was continuously made. In such a case, the packaging of the film on the tray may not be performed or may be incomplete.

An object of the present invention is to provide an apparatus for confirming whether or not a predetermined amount of film drawn from a film winding roll is reliably supplied to a packaging unit.

As shown in FIGS. 1 and 2, in the film take-up roll supporting device C, rotating rollers 3 and 4 are fitted to a pair of fixed shafts 1 and 2 arranged side by side. A film take-up roll 5 is placed on 4. The film 6 pulled out from the film take-up roll 5 has one rotating roller 3
It is wound around.

At one end of one of the rotating rollers 3, a photoelectric sensor 7 is provided as a film withdrawing amount detecting means. The photoelectric sensor 7 includes a tooth plate 8 that rotates integrally with the rotating roller 3.
And a rotary encoder 9 which is turned on and off by the concave and convex portions on the outer periphery of the tooth plate 8. The rotary encoder 9 is connected to the CPU 10 as shown in FIG.

As shown in FIG. 1 and FIGS. 3 and 4, the film supply device D includes a fixed gripping member 11 for gripping the leading end of the film 6 pulled out from the film winding roll 5, and And a movable gripping member 12 for gripping the leading end of the film 6 on the fixed gripping member 11 so as to approach and separate.

The fixed holding member 11 includes a fixed holding plate 13 and a movable holding plate 14 that can be opened and closed with each other, and upper and lower holding rollers that can be opened and closed with each other.
15 and 16 are provided, and the leading end of the film 6 passes between the two holding rollers 15 and 16 and is held between the two holding plates 13 and 14. The upper holding roller 15 is linked to the brake 17. A cutting groove 18 is provided in the fixed gripping member 11 above the holding plates 13 and 14.

The movable gripping member 12 is supported on the rotation shaft 19 so as to be movable in the axial direction. The movable gripping member 12 is provided with a fixed gripping plate 20 and a movable gripping plate 21 that can be opened and closed, and a knife 22 positioned above the fixed gripping plate 20 and the movable gripping plate 21.

Below the fixed holding member 11, a solenoid 23 is attached, and between the solenoid 23 and the rotating shaft 19, and between the rotating shaft 19 and the movable holding plate 21 of the movable holding member 12, wires 24, Two
5 are connected. The movable gripping plate 21 is
Is opened and closed via the wire 24, the rotating shaft 19 and the wire 25 in accordance with the de-energization of. A rotary belt 26 is connected to the movable holding member 12, and the rotary belt 26 is rotated by a drive motor 27 as a drive unit. When the belt 26 rotates, the movable holding member 12 approaches and separates from the fixed holding member 11.

As shown in FIG. 5, a rotary encoder 28 as a movable gripping member moving amount detecting means is interlocked with the drive motor 27, and the rotary encoder 28 is connected to the CPU 10 as shown in FIG. And the detection signal is input to the CPU 10.

In the program memory 10a, in addition to the control program, the optimal film withdrawal amount L according to the width W of the tray 40 and the drive stop of the drive motor 27 that determines the stop position of the movable gripping member 12 so as to achieve the withdrawal amount L The timing is stored in advance.

As shown in FIGS. 1 and 6, a film folding device E is provided above the film supply device D. The film folding device E includes a front folding member 30, a rear folding member 31, and both left and right folding members 32. As shown in FIGS. 1 and 6, a heater device F is disposed in front of and in front of the front folding member 30 of the film folding device E. Further, as shown in FIGS. 1 and 7, above the film folding device E, there is provided an article unloading device G over which a unloading belt 33 is stretched.

Now, in the film supply device D, as shown in FIG. 9 (a), when the movable gripping member 12 is separated from the fixed gripping member 11 and the film 6 is stretched between the gripping members 11, 12, The film 6 pulled out from the film take-up roll 5 passes between the upper and lower holding rollers 15 and 16 of the fixed holding member 11, and is held between the fixed holding plate 13 and the movable holding plate 14 of the fixed holding member 11. At the same time, the movable holding member 12 is held between the fixed holding plate 20 and the movable holding plate 21. The upper holding roller 15 cannot rotate due to the operation of the brake 17.

Articles in this state (those with items stored in tray 40)
As shown in FIG. 9 (b), when the receiving table 34 on which the film is loaded rises, the film 6 is moved between the upper and lower holding rollers 15 and 16 and between the fixed holding plate 20 and the movable holding plate 21 of the movable holding member 12. The film 6 is stretched to cover the tray 40 from above by being lifted to the packaging section S while being pressed.

Next, when the rear folding member 31 approaches the front folding member 30, the left and right folding members 32 close each other, and the rear folding member 31 and the left and right folding members 32 bite into the film 6 below the tray 40. When the rear folding member 31 and the left and right folding members 32 bite into the lower side of the tray 40 to a certain extent and the tray 40 is placed, the article receiving table 34 descends. Then, as shown in FIG. 9 (c), the film 6 is folded under the tray 40 by the rear folding member 31 and the left and right folding members 32 from both the rear and left and right directions. At the time of this insertion,
The holding of the film 6 by the movable holding member 12 is released.

Thereafter, the movable holding member 12 approaches the fixed holding member 11. After the folding by the rear folding member 31 and the left and right folding members 32, the carry-out belt 33 of the article carrying-out device G is rotated, and the tray 40 is carried out toward the front folding member 30 as shown in FIG. It rests on the folding member 30. The front folding member 30 cuts into the film 6 below the tray 40. In synchronization with the unloading of the tray 40, the knife 22 of the movable gripping member 12 is inserted into the cutting groove 18 of the fixed gripping member 11, and the film 6 is pushed by the knife 22 and bites into the cutting groove 18, and the film 6 is cut by the knife 22. Is disconnected. After this cutting, the brake 17 is released and the upper holding roller 15 becomes rotatable, the holding of the film 6 is released, and the movable holding plate 21 of the movable holding member 12 is released.
Is closed, and the leading end of the film 6 on the fixed holding member 11 is held by the movable holding member 12.

Then, as shown in FIG. 9 (e), the movable holding member 12 is separated from the fixed holding member 11. At this time, a detection signal from the article width detection sensor 29 is already input to the CPU 10, and based on the detection signal, the CPU 10 reads the drive stop timing of the drive motor 27 from the program memory 10a, and controls the drive motor 27 at the drive stop timing. Stop. Drive motor
When the moving member 27 stops, the movable gripping member 12 also stops, and the film 6 gripped by the movable gripping member 12 or the film 6 is pulled out from the film take-up roll 5, and as shown in FIG.
It is stretched between 11,12. The rear folding member 31 is separated from the front folding member 30, and the left and right folding members 32 are opened from each other.

As shown in FIG. 9 (b), when the tray 40 is placed at the center of the starting end of the article transport conveyor 35 during the folding of the film 6, the tray 40 is sent toward the article receiving table 34, and the conveyor 35 is moved.
It comes into contact with the stopper member 36 protruding upward and temporarily stops.
When the article receiving tray 34 comes to the lowermost position and the stopper member 36 sinks below the conveyor 35 in synchronization with this, the tray 40 is fed again as shown in FIG. The conveyor 35 comes into contact and stops at the end of the conveyor 35. In the tray 40 on the front folding member 30, the film 6 is also folded from the front, and is placed on the front folding member 30, where the lower folded portion of the tray 40 is brought into close contact with the heater device F.

When the article receiving tray 34 is raised, the tray 40 is wrapped with the film 6 in the same manner as described above.

As described above, in the packaging machine of the present embodiment, the supply of the tray 40 is performed in the first cycle, and the film 6 below the tray 40 is supplied.
Is performed in the second cycle, and the unloading of the tray 40 is performed in the third cycle, and the supply, folding, and unloading proceed simultaneously.

During this packaging process, the CPU 10 reads a predetermined film withdrawal amount L from the program memory 10a based on the detection signal from the article width detection sensor 29, and detects the actual film withdrawal amount detected by the photoelectric sensor 7 as the film withdrawal amount detecting means. When they do not coincide with each other as compared with L, a signal is sent to the packing machine operation stop selecting means 38 to stop the packing machine in the initial state of each cycle. When they match, the continuous operation of the packaging machine is continued.

In particular, in this embodiment, when the film take-up roll 5 rotates by the amount L of film 6 pulled out, the rotating roller 3 around which the film 6 is wound also rotates by the amount L drawn out of the film 6 and the rotation of the roller 3 is stopped. Since the number of pulses is detected by the photoelectric sensor 7 as the film withdrawing amount detecting means, the actual withdrawal amount L of the film 6 can be detected regardless of the increase or decrease of the film 6 on the film winding roll 5.

Further, the film 6 is gripped at the distal end by the movable gripping member 12, and the movable gripping member 12 is actually pulled out from the film winding roll 5 by moving in the film pulling-out direction. Since the rotating roller 3 serving as a basis for detecting the film withdrawal amount L is actually rotated, the film withdrawal amount L is not detected unless the film 6 is actually withdrawn by the movable gripping member 12. In the case of a drawer failure, it is possible to eliminate the possibility of erroneously detecting that the drawer is normally drawn.
